What is a Lean-To Conservatory?
A lean-to conservatory is basically a sunroom attached to the side of a house, identified by its uncomplicated design including a single-pitched roofing system. This architectural style is specifically fit for residential or commercial properties with restricted garden area, as it enhances readily available areas while maintaining a smooth circulation between indoor and outside environments.
